Job Summary
We are seeking a highly organised and proactive Sales Administrator to join our team. The successful candidate will provide essential support to the sales department, ensuring smooth operations and effective communication with clients. This role requires excellent administrative skills, strong computer literacy, and the ability to manage multiple tasks efficiently. The Sales Administrator will play a vital part in maintaining accurate records, preparing sales reports, and supporting customer service initiatives to enhance client satisfaction.
Duties
- Manage and update customer information using CRM software to ensure data accuracy and accessibility.
- Prepare and organise sales documentation, including quotes, proposals, and contracts using Microsoft Word and PowerPoint.
- Assist in processing sales orders and invoices via Sage accounting software.
- Coordinate with the sales team to schedule meetings, follow-ups, and client appointments.
- Respond promptly to customer enquiries via email and phone, providing excellent customer service.
- Maintain organised records of sales activities, correspondence, and client interactions.
- Generate regular sales reports using Microsoft Excel for management review.
- Support the team with administrative tasks such as filing, data entry, and document management using Microsoft Office tools.
- Contribute to continuous improvement of administrative processes within the sales department.
Requirements
- Proven experience in sales administration or similar administrative roles.
- Strong organisational skills with excellent time management abilities.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ook).
- Experience with CRM software and Sage accounting system is desirable.
- Good communication skills in English, both written and verbal.
- Demonstrated computer literacy and IT skills relevant to office administration.
- Ability to work independently as well as part of a team in a fast-paced environment.
- Attention to detail and accuracy in data entry and record keeping.
